Fellow Adelaide blogger Katherine of Caught Couture has created the Uglee Challenge. It's all about taking some bad fashion-disaster-level item and turning it into something amazing! Divine Madness is an up-coming label, from my own lovely city Adelaide. The creator, Alice Rawlinson, will be showcasing her two collections at the Hotel Richmond with two short parades at 6pm and 7pm on the 3rd of September (that's tonight people!).
